NAFFIE , BETTE J. "Dancing faces you toward Heaven, whichever direction you turn." Bette J. Naffie, age 83, of Manistee, beloved wife, mother, grandmother and great-grandmother, died unexpectedly but peacefully at her home May 26, 2011. Born September 11, 1927 in Bay City, Michigan, she was the...
